The French equivalent of 'My birthday is on...' is Mon anniversaire, c'est le... . In the word-by-word translation, the possessive adjective 'mon' means 'my'. The noun 'anniversaire' means 'birthday'. The demonstrative pronoun 'ce'* means 'this is'. The verb 'est' means '[he/she/it] is'. The definite article 'le' means 'the'. *The letter 'e' is dropped before a word that begins with a vowel or an unaspirated 'h'.
